Abstract: | In compliance with the requirements of the Shengli Oil Field of Shandong, China, the effect of seawater salinity (30‐5) on the electrochemical properties of Al‐basis sacrificial anode was studied under laboratory conditions by the method given in the Chinese National Standard GB4948‐85 (Sacrificial Anode of Al–Zn–In System Alloy) 1]. The results showed that there was no obvious effect when the seawater salinity varied from 30 to 10, but that the anodic open circuit potential, closed circuit potential and current efficiency at seawater salinity of 5 were lower than those given in the Chinese National Standard. The variation of seawater salinity must be considered while designing marine projects in estuary areas. |
